This second installment of PVCC's new "Films Talk Back" series features a 65-minute documentary film by local Academy Award and Emmy Award-winning filmmaker Paul Wagner, who will follow up the screening with a Q&A.
Good Work: Masters of the Building Arts explores the lives and works of artisans from across America working in the building trades. Eight segments follow accomplished decorative painters, terra cotta and adobe builders, stone masons, stained glass craftsmen, ornamental metalsmiths and stone carvers. The film celebrates American craftsmanship, occupational traditions, the beauty of our built environment, and the importance of "Good Work."
